Hi,
I re-started Wellington User Group after some years of no activity (https://wiki.postgresql.org/wiki/NZPgUG, http://www.meetup.com/Wellington-PostgreSQL-User-Group) and while discussing the mailing list for the group, I was pointed to http://www.postgresql.org/list/group/6/ . I was wondering what do I need to do to get a mailing list for Wellington User Group through postgresql.org?
Congrats on restarting the PUG!
Creating a mailing list through @postgresql.org requires the pginfra team to set it up. Based on some discussions about PUG mailing lists being supported by pginfra, I would recommend using the mailing list feature on Meetup for your PUG.
I would be happy to create a listing for the PUG on PostgreSQL.org, which I am doing as we speak.
